Job summary

Illinois Institute of Technology is looking for an Assistant Director for Student Success and Retention. This role includes overseeing programming and operations for scholarship cohorts and first-generation student success initiatives. The Assistant Director will lead the development of a peer mentorship program, collaborate with various partners, and provide leadership for first-generation students.

A Bachelor's degree is required, and a Master's in a related field is preferred. The position offers a salary range of $50,000 – $55,000 annually, with a commitment to a supportive campus environment.

Qualifications

  • At least two years of relevant experience with a complex institution such as a university, school system, or not-for-profit agency.

Responsibilities

  • Recruit, supervise, train, and evaluate 10-15 student peer mentors.
  • Partner with Undergraduate Admission for outreach and strategic enrollment initiatives.
  • Provide leadership and administration for first-generation students and scholarship cohorts.
  • Serve as official representative for the Hope Chicago program.
  • Plan and facilitate educational initiatives supporting student leadership development.
  • Create and maintain partnerships across the division to enhance retention and success.

Education

Bachelor’s degree
Master’s degree in Higher Education, Student Affairs, Counseling, Educational Leadership, or related field
